Can I take a ferry from Agathonisi to Astypalea?

Yes, ferries run between Agathonisi and Astypalea. This route is operated by Dodekanisos Seaways, and takes around 5h 10min on average. Ferries are available weekly.

Fastest ferry from Agathonisi to Astypalea

The fastest ferry from Agathonisi to Astypalea is DODEKANISOS PRIDE, operated by Dodekanisos Seaways, which takes just 5h 10min.

Exploring Astypalea

Astypalea is a beautiful island in Greece that feels like a hidden treasure! Its white-washed houses with blue doors and windows look like something out of a fairy tale. You can visit the impressive Venetian Castle on the hill for amazing views and explore the charming town with cute shops and cafes. The beaches are simply stunning! Don’t miss the soft sands of Kaminakia Beach and the crystal-clear waters of Plakes Beach.

If you love tasty food, try local dishes like “mousaka” and fresh seafood at small tavernas. For adventure, you can hike along scenic trails and discover little coves just waiting to be found. Astypalea is also perfect for short visits, but it’s a fantastic starting point to explore nearby islands like Nisyros and Kalymnos.
